The Tune Belt iPod Armband Carrier

Have an iPod, or thinking about picking up one of the cool new iPod Minis that Steve Jobs announced this week at Macworld Expo? While the new iPod Mini comes with a belt clip, your belt isn't necessarily the ideal place to carry your 'Pod. It's a long way from your belt to your ear, and the pod could get spilled on, could be uncomfortable when seated, and so on.

Tune Belt Inc. of Cincinnati, Ohio, has another solution -- an armband case for the iPod added to their extensive fleet of belt and armband cases for a variety of consumer electronic equipment. This innovative little number is engineered to carry the iPod in an upside-down orientation so that when your arm is raised slightly with the case flap open, the 'Pod's LCD screen will appear right side up. Clever.




Other design features include open access for the touch wheel and touch buttons, a clear protection window for the LCD screen, an opening in the bottom for the headphone jack or remote cords to pass through, and a handy zip-closure pocket on the case flap to store the earbud headphones or other small bits.

The Tune Belt iPod Armband Carrier comes in either jet black or royal blue, and has a diagonal reflective silver accent stripe paralleling the pocket zipper for a sporty look and to enhance night time safety when walking or bicycling.

The Carrier's armband is made from a soft, slightly elastic Neoprene material, and adjusts up to 20 inches circumference. I found it easy to adjust and quite comfortable to wear. The Carrier itself is made from the same soft stretchy Neoprene fabric (reminded me of wetsuit material) with a nylon panel lining the inside the flap, which is secured with a Velcro closure.

The Tune Belt iPod Armband Carrier appears to be well-made, with neat, sturdy stitching, and a sturdy and amply-sized adjuster buckle the arm band.




A well as being a convenient and functional way to carry your iPod, the Tune Belt iPod Armband Carrier should do a good job of protecting the iPod from bumps and scratches. It should also be easy to care for itself too, since Neoprene is easily washable.

The Tune Belt iPod Armband Carrier allows a much shorter length of earphone cord to be exposed then if the 'Pod was fastened to your belt, lessening the potential for snags and in general just less cumbersome.

The Steel Gaming Glove GG3

Another interesting product from the Steelpad folks in Denmark -- the Steel Gaming Glove is a fingerless hand cover with an elasticized wrist support designed especially for serious gamers, helping them shave that last five percent of friction to provide a competitive edge.




The glove part is made from light, stretchy Lycra or a similar elasticized fabric. The wrist support is of heavier elastic with a Velcro closure. I found the Steel Gaming Glove comfortable to wear, and it does allow your hand to slide more slickly across the mousepad. The Steel Gaming Glove comes only in a right-handed model, and is "one size fits all." I have a fairly long (8 inches from the tip of my big finger to the first wrist crease), narrow hand, and I found it fit me fine, but I'm not testing the stretchiness of the Lycra material at all. The glove will obviously accommodate a wide range of hand sizes.




I found the Steel Gaming Glove to be well made and finished, with robust stitching and neat fabric hems. I expect that it will prove durable in use, the surface that it contacts having some bearing on its life span.

Poor Man's Cinema Display?

This section of today's column is not a review, but a just an overview at the DoubleSight Dual 15" LCD Monitor as a cost-effective standard for alternative to large, bulky CRTs & expensive widescreen LCD Monitors.

Bummed because a 20" Cinema Display is too rich for your budget? DoubleSight Displays, LLC's dual 15-inch LCD monitor could be the more affordable solution.

The benefit of using multiple monitors is instant and immense because the user can display a different program or document on each monitor at the same time. Are you dealing with multiple windows? Then DoubleSight could be an ideal and more affordable solution for you.

The new DoubleSight dual LCD monitor is an attractive, cost effective alternative to large CRT monitors that consume a lot of physical desktop space or expensive LCD monitors like Apple's Cinema Displays. DoubleSight harnesses your information and computing power utilizing a unique approach to the multiple monitor feature to enhance the user's viewing and productivity experience. Featuring DoubleSight Displays' patent-pending multiple monitor "smart control" technology, the $799 DoubleSight DS-1500 harnesses two 15-inch LCD flat panels with 2048 x 768 resolution in a side-by-side configuration mounted on a single, space-efficient base stand. DoubleSight provides large monitor real estate in a small footprint at a very affordable cost.

Supported by Macintosh and Windows computers, the DoubleSight DS-1500 seamlessly displays as much data as a single 20-inch monitor and manages several sources of information without time-consuming switching between windows. By performing fast reactions to multiple information sources, DoubleSight users can experience significant productivity increases ranging from approximately 20 to 50 percent by easily managing their multiple programs simultaneously. Unlike large-screen monitors that often sacrifice legibility to offer more desktop space under a high resolution, the DoubleSight dual LCD monitor can effectively provide large desktop space in a legible format.

DoubleSight's patent-pending "Intelligent Multi-screen Control Mechanism" technology and industrial design employ a single controlling motherboard that seamlessly manages and adjusts the display of multi-screen monitors. By distributing or replicating signals to both display panels, users have the ability to display a different window on each monitor panel at the same time, or stretch Excel spreadsheets across two monitors so they can see more columns without scrolling. While using one monitor to do research on the Web, users can summarize their data in a Word document on the other monitor panel. DoubleSight's one-stop access for controlling dual displays also includes intuitive menu-driven on-screen display controls for selecting how the user wants to set up each LCD panel.




The DoubleSight DS-1500 combines attractive techno avant-garde appearance with a unique, light yet sturdy design that requires a minimum of desk space. The strength of DoubleSight's industrial design is attributed to its unique aluminum tilt and swivel base that supports horizontal and vertical movement of the LCD panels. With its simplified, slim flat panel design, DoubleSight can be placed on a desk, is VESA wall-mountable, or may be hung from an office cubicle.

DoubleSight can be connected to computers with two VGA ports, one VGA port and a DVI port, or to two separate computers by attaching one VGA cable to each computer. Additionally, DoubleSight is powered through a single power cord providing a simplified cabling solution.

The viewable area of the DoubleSight dual LCD monitor is 24 inches (horizontal) by 9 inches (vertical) with a minimal center bezel that allows for optimal display continuity. The two combined LCD panels generate a 2048 x 768 resolution, with each panel pre-set to a maximum of 1024 x 768 at 75Hz. Apple's 20" Cinema Display offers 1680 x 1050 at its optimal resolution. Each DoubleSight 15-inch panel produces sharp images with a high brightness rate of 250cd/m2 and a 400:1 contrast ratio. The display features a 130� horizontal/ 100� vertical viewing angle, a fast response time of 25ms, a sharp pixel pitch of 0.297mm, 16M maximum displayable colors, and 30,000 hours minimum lamp life.
